接詳細介紹Linux shell腳本基礎學習(一)我們來看一下shell中Here documents和函數的使用。 6. Here documents HERE Document是bash里面定義塊變量的途徑之一 定義的形式為: 命令<<HERE ...
Linux shell腳本基礎學習,雖然不涉及具體東西,但是打好基礎是以后學習輕松地前提。 Linux 腳本編寫基礎 . 語法基本介紹 . . 開頭 程序必須以下面的行開始 必須方在文件的第一行 : bin sh 符號 用來告訴系統它后面的參數是用來執行該文件的程序。在這個例子中我們使用 bin sh來執行程序。 當編輯好腳本時,如果要執行該腳本,還必須使其可執行。 要使腳本可執行: 編譯 chm ...
2013-01-31 10:41 9 18811 推薦指數:
接詳細介紹Linux shell腳本基礎學習(一)我們來看一下shell中Here documents和函數的使用。 6. Here documents HERE Document是bash里面定義塊變量的途徑之一 定義的形式為: 命令<<HERE ...
第十一章 BASH腳本(一) 常見的Shell變量的類型包括環境變量、預定義變量、位置變量、用戶自定義變量。本節將分別學習這四種Shell變量的使用。 11. 1、 Shell的環境變量 通過set命令可以查看系統中所有Shell變量(包括環境變量和用戶自定義變量 ...
【實驗目的】 通過本實驗練習,使學生了解常用SHELL的編程特點,掌握SHELL 程序設計的基礎知識。對SHELL程序流程控制、SHELL程序的運行方式、bash程序的調試方法及bash的常用內部命令有進一步的認識和理解。 【實驗內容】 編寫shell腳本 ...
目錄 一、編寫簡單的腳本 二、接收用戶參數 三、判斷用戶參數 文件測試語句 邏輯測試 整數值比較 字符串比較符 四、條件測試語句 單分支結構 雙分支結構 多分支結構 ...
’ =兩側不能有空格,使用變量 ${aa} Shell特殊含義變量 $$ 取當前腳本的進程id,就是 ...
1.程序流程控制實例 程序流程控制,實際上就是改變程序的執行順序。程序在執行過程中若流程被改變,就可能導致輸出不同,因此利用這一特性就能夠實現程序執行結果的控制。程序流程控制可分為“選擇”和“循環” ...
Shell腳本學習之expect命令 一、概述 我們通過Shell可以實現簡單的控制流功能,如:循環、判斷等。但是對於需要交互的場合則必須通過人工來干預,有時候我們可能會需要實現和交互程序如telnet服務器等進行交互的功能。而expect就使用來實現這種功能的工具 ...
今天繼續講Linux基礎知識,內容是關於bash shell的。分享以下bash shell的相關知識,例如基本特性等。 1.8)bash shell的介紹 1.8.1)什么是bash shell 概括地講就是bash shell是一個命令解釋器,與內核進行交互。 bash shell ...